Hi folks,

we waited desperately for the new firmware release, claiming to fix the BLF issues in conjunction with Asterisk 1.4. So far, they have done a good job to fix the "being busy indicator" (if someone is busy on the phone). But if a phone is switched off the BLF LED still indicates with a green (available) light on the other phones. Miss-leading the lady's at the Front Desk and let them forward to someone who is not at the office any more.
Is there also a patch coming, or is it a simple configuration matter?

Many thanks in advance.
